    • A novel process for producing a 7-substituted-3,5-dihydroxy carboxylic acid compound useful as an HMG-CoA reductase inhibitor, and novel 6-heptynoic and heptenoic acid compounds, respectively represented by general formulae (1) and (2), useful as the starting material for the above process, wherein Z represents (3) or (4); A represents -CO- or -CHOR1- (wherein R1 represents hydrogen or a hydroxyl-protecting group) and B represents -CO- or -CHOR2- (wherein R2 represents hydrogen or a hydroxyl-protecting group), provided that R1 and R2 may be combined together to form a ring; R3 represents hydrogen, C1-C8 alkyl, aralkyl, aryl, silyl, lithium, sodium, potassium, calcium or RpRqRrNH (wherein Rp, Rq and Rr represent each independently hydrogen, C1-C8 alkyl, aralkyl or aryl); R6 represents hydrogen or a protective group for triple bonds; and L represents borane, aluminum, zirconium, magnesium or silyl each substituted by C1-C9 alkyl, alkylene, aralkyl, aryl, alkoxy, substituted phenoyx or halogen. The use of the invention compounds and process enables an efficient production of a 7-substituted-3,5-dihydroxy carboxlylic acid compound useful as an HMG-CoA reductase inhibitor.
